Located in the north bank of the Yangtze River and the east mouth of the Three Gorges, Yichang City has a history of more than 2,400 years. Also known as Yiling in ancient times, Yichang is one of the cradles of the Chu culture. The city occupies a total area of 21,600 square kilometers and has a population of 4 million. With geographical advantages, Yichang has been a commodity distribution center and transport hub for west Hubei Province and east Sichuan Province since ancient times. The convenient water transport channel helps Yichang reach Sichuan in the west and Jiangsu and Shanghai in the east. Geographical features of Yichang are diverse, with mountains, hills and plains. The terrain of Yichang tilts towards southeast from northwest, with Daba Mountain in the northwest part, Wushan Mountain in the central part and Wuling Mountain in the southwest part. Yidu, Zhijiang, Dangyang and Yuan¡¦an in the east of Yichang are hilly and plain areas. In subtropical monsoon zone of humid climate, Yichang has distinctive four seasons, with longer springs and autumns. Annual average rainfall is between 992.1 to 1,404.1 millimeters. Majority of rains are in June and July. With comparatively high temperature, Yichang has an annual average temperature of 13.1¢J~18¢J and a long frog-free period.
Yichang is the hometown of the famous poet Qu Yuan in the Warring States Period and Wang Zhaojun in the Han Dynasty, with the cultural relics of Qu Yuan Temple and Zhaojun Village. The Dangyang, Zhijiang and Yuan¡¦an area in northeast Yichang has been a strategic place. In the Three Kingdom period, the major battles between Wei and Shu states and between Wu and Shu states all took place in this area, having left many historic sites such as ancient battlefield Changbanpo, Tomb of General Guan Yu, the place where General Guan Yu made its power felt, the Maicheng ruins and Huimapo, etc. The Changyang and Wufeng area in southwest Yichang is known for its Ba culture, Tujia ethnic folk custom and beautiful natural sceneries of mountains and waters.
